Potato Caramel Cake 

For this  Potato Caramel Cake  you will need

1/2 Cupful of Butter 

2 Cupfuls of Sugar 

2 Cupfuls of Flour 

1 Cupful of Hot Mashed Potato 

1/2 Cupful of  Fresh Sweet  Milk 

4 Eggs 

2 Teaspoonfuls of Baking Powder (Calumet or Glabber Girl works the best)

1 Cupful of Grated Chocolate or 2 Squares of Melted Chocolate 

1 Cupful of Chopped English Walnuts 

1 Teaspoonful Each of 

Powdered Cloves 
Cinnamon and 
Nutmeg 

1 Teaspoonful of Vanilla Extract 

Cream the butter and the sugar, add  to the cream the yolks of the eggs, the  mashed potato, the spices, the vanilla extract, and then mix in slowly the baking powder mixed with the flour, milk whites of  the cold eggs stiffly beaten and the chopped. Baked in a buttered-and-floured cake pan in a moderate oven. When it is  cold cover with frosting.
